- Mangesh AzadJun 28, 2022 · 4 years agoA trailing stop is a type of stop-loss order that automatically adjusts as the price of a cryptocurrency fluctuates. It is designed to protect profits by allowing traders to set a specific percentage or dollar amount below the current market price. If the price of the cryptocurrency falls by the specified percentage or amount, the trailing stop order is triggered and the position is sold. The trailing stop order will continue to adjust as the price increases, allowing traders to capture more profit if the price continues to rise. This can be a useful tool for managing risk and maximizing profits in volatile cryptocurrency markets.
- ShopInShop FranchiseSep 20, 2025 · 6 months agoTrailing stop is like having a personal assistant who constantly monitors the price of a cryptocurrency for you. It automatically adjusts the stop-loss level as the price moves in your favor. Let's say you set a trailing stop at 5%. If the price of the cryptocurrency increases by 5%, the stop-loss level will also move up by 5%. This means that even if the price starts to decline, your position will only be sold if it falls by more than 5%. This allows you to ride the uptrend and lock in profits along the way. It's a great tool for traders who want to protect their gains without constantly monitoring the market.
